Why did Moses die?
Moses died without getting to see the Promised Land because the second time he gave the people water on his own authority.
The first time Moses gave people water, by striking his staff against a rock, t Sinai, he did so on the Lords direction, in the name of the Lord. (Exodus 17:6)
The second time Moses gave the people by striking a rock, at kKadesh, as instructed by the Lord (Numbers 20:8-12), Moses adds is own comments of frustration and attitude – “… and he said unto them, Hear now, ye rebels; must we fetch you water out of this rock?” (Numbers 20:10)
Christendom will tell you that because Moses added his own negative words in Numbers 20:10 God made Moses die before entering the Promised Land. Sort of like, the people are moving on now and you cannot go with them so die as a punishment.
Deu 32:49 Get thee up into this mountain Abarim, unto mount Nebo, which is in the land of Moab, that is over against Jericho; and behold the land of Canaan, which I give unto the children of Israel for a possession: 50 And die in the mount whither thou goest up, and be gathered unto thy people; as Aaron thy brother died in mount Hor, and was gathered unto his people: 51 Because ye trespassed against me among the children of Israel at the waters of Meribah-Kadesh, in the wilderness of Zin; because ye sanctified me not in the midst of the children of Israel. 52 Yet thou shalt see the land before thee; but thou shalt not go thither unto the land which I give the children of Israel.
However, Talmudic Jewish commentary suggests that Moses died because he had reach his life span limit of 120 years as commanded in Genesis 6:3 “… (man’s) days shall be an hundred and twenty years.” According to Talmudic legend Moses died on 7 Adar (day and month), exactly on his 120th birthday.
Deu 34:7 And Moses was an hundred and twenty years old when he died: his eye was not dim, nor his natural force abated..
Deu 34:5 So Moses the servant of the LORD died there in the land of Moab, according to the word of the LORD. (the command of the Lord as a punishment in Christendom – or the scripture of Gen 6:3, if you are Jewish)
Deu 34:6 And He (God) buried him (Moses)in a valley in the land of Moab, over against Bethpeor: but no man knoweth of his sepulchre (grave/tomb)unto this day.
Joseph Smith, Jr. and Oliver Cowdery, of the Mormon Church of Latter Day Saints, stated that on April 3, 1836, that no one could ever find the grave site of Moses because Moses was taken to heaven (translated or transfigured) without having tasted death.
The real punishment for Moses was not when he died, but where he died – Deu 32:52 Yet thou shalt see the land before thee; but thou shalt not go thither unto the land which I give the children of Israel.
